Global 3D printing medical devices market size was valued at USD 3.38 billion in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 13.35 billion by 2031, with a CAGR of 18.72% during the forecast period of 2024 to 2031.

**Segments**

- **Technology**: The 3D printing medical devices market can be segmented based on technology into droplet deposition (DD), electron beam melting (EBM), laser beam melting (LBM), photopolymerization, and three-dimensional printing (3DP) or adhesion bonding.
- **Component**: Segmentation based on components includes three major categories - equipment (3D printers, 3D bioprinters), materials (biocompatible material, non-biomaterial, ceramic, metal, polymer), and software & services (design software, production software, scanning & image processing software, inspection software).
- **Application**: This market segment can be categorized based on application as surgical guides, surgical instruments, prosthetics and implants, tissue engineering, hearing aids, wearables, dental implants, and other applications.
- **End User**: The end-user segment comprises hospitals, diagnostic centers, academic and research institutes, ambulatory surgical centers.
